| Mount | Surface Mount |
| Mounting Type | Surface Mount |
| Package / Case | 28-LCC (J-Lead) |
| Number of Pins | 28 |
| Operating Temperature | -40°C~85°C |
| Packaging | Tape & Reel (TR) |
| Series | 100LVE |
| Published | 2006 |
| JESD-609 Code | e0 |
| Part Status | Obsolete |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|
| Number of Terminations | 28 |
| Type | Fanout Buffer (Distribution) |
| Terminal Finish | Tin/Lead (Sn/Pb) |
| Additional Feature | NECL MODE: VCC = 0V WITH VEE = -3V TO -3.8V |
| Voltage - Supply | 3V~3.8V |
| Terminal Position | QUAD |
| Terminal Form | J BEND |
| Peak Reflow Temperature (Cel) | 240 |
| Number of Functions | 2 |
| Supply Voltage | 3.3V |
| Reach Compliance Code | not_compliant |
| Time@Peak Reflow Temperature-Max (s) | 30 |
| Base Part Number | MC100LVE210 |
| Output | ECL, PECL |
| Pin Count | 28 |
| Number of Outputs | 18 |
| Qualification Status | Not Qualified |
| Supply Voltage-Max (Vsup) | 3.8V |
| Power Supplies | -3.3V |
| Supply Voltage-Min (Vsup) | 3V |
| Number of Circuits | 2 |
| Propagation Delay | 900 ps |
| Frequency (Max) | 700MHz |
| Input | ECL, PECL |
| Ratio - Input:Output | 1:4, 1:5 |
| Differential - Input:Output | Yes/Yes |
| Prop. Delay@Nom-Sup | 0.75 ns |
| Same Edge Skew-Max (tskwd) | 0.075 ns |
| Length | 11.505mm |
| Height Seated (Max) | 4.57mm |
| Width | 11.505mm |
| RoHS Status | Non-RoHS Compliant |
| Lead Free | Contains Lead |
